>>Seven Community Organizations To Receive State Funding To Help With Juneteenth Celebrations
(Harrisburg, PA) -- Governor Tom Wolf's Office announced yesterday that 89-thousand-dollars in Journey Through Freedom grants would be split among seven groups across the state for Juneteenth celebrations. The Pennsylvania Tourism Office is providing the grants. Groups were awarded money based on their historical significance, educational outreach, and volunteer resources. Juneteenth is held every year in remembrance of the June 19th, 1865 announcement that slavery had been abolished in the United States.
